Tested back to back with my wife's V20 using the included AKG earbuds using a high fidelity flac file of the Allman Brothers song Old Friend, which is two acoustic guitars with strong vocals. Night and day, there was far more detail and less hiss using the V20. Tested also with hih quality flac files of Metallica and Andrea Bocelli. Same. Far more detail.
Used Poweramp Alpha with high fidelity output enabled. Nothing scientific, just back to hack.
I mostly like the Note 8 otherwise, but for sound quality alone I think I'll return for the V30 when it comes out. Haven't Used the S Pen hardly at all, which surprised me. For me, audio quality is important.

I have the Note FE, Note 8 and LG V20.
Note 8 is much better than the Note FE but no way as good as the V20 when you use 24 bit music (Lossless). But I believe most consumers use streaming services which use high but rate MP3s so most so consumers would be happy with the Note 8. I am not which is why I use a dedicated Sony NW ZX300 DAP.

I don't have the phone and only played with android briefly before, but in theory, what you are describing is known as "normalizing", where the device tries to make the songs sound as even as possible. This results in capped louder parts and sometimes increased quieter parts. Is there any option like this in the equalizer?

The audio chip in the S9+ is the same as in the S8 series.
Cirrus Logic CS47L93 Audio Codec.
Source:
http://techinsights.com/about-techinsights/overview/blog/samsung-galaxy-s9-teardown/
